Primary school-based food environment intervention increases diet diversity: Project Daire, a cluster randomized controlled trial

This study explored the effects of Project Daire, a school-based food intervention, on secondary dietary outcomes Diet Diversity Score (DDS) and Diet Quality Score (DQS), among 6–7 and 10-11-year-old children.
